What is Death?

A Scientist Looks at the Cycle of Life

En savoir plus sur le livre

Exploring the concept of death through a broader ecological lens reveals its integral role in the cycle of life. Rather than viewing death solely as an individual event, the book emphasizes its connection to the biosphere, illustrating how it contributes to the richness of life on Earth. By examining the interplay between death and life, the narrative invites readers to contemplate the significance of death in sustaining ecosystems and the evolutionary processes that shape the world. Ultimately, understanding death requires acknowledging its place within the vast web of life.
